In an IDE, I look for features that will help save my time. Basics liks Search/Replace, syntax highlighting etc, you'd expect in a text editor anyway. The real gains are to be made when you can make your projects modular and component based and being able to utilise these modules easily from within your tools without having to spend hours configuring build environments etc, is a big time saver.
I noticed that someone had mentioned Visaj. Visaj is a Java GUI builder so if you're working on front ends, it's ideal. You can save your custom widgets on a palette and reuse them again at any time. Plus it supports Swing and I was able to download it for free.
